Based on previous encounter many years back, I suspect the used car I just bought had the front windscreen coated with such product. One wiper blade already slightly damaged. The wipers shudders on the rising stroke each time. Anyone got some ideas how to remove the chemical?

Use mama lemon + newspaper...if not u got to let it run out...if rain every 2-3 days...the raid x should be gone in around 1mth time at most...
